What are the main advantages of using a transparent LED screen?

Transparent LED screens revolutionize the way businesses and individuals engage with their audience. These screens combine high functionality with aesthetic appeal, making them an exciting choice for public displays. One standout advantage involves their striking visual impact and flexibility of application. With transparency rates of up to 80%, these screens allow viewers to see digital content alongside the real-world surroundings. This feature splendidly merges digital and physical worlds, particularly enhancing retail storefronts and exhibition spaces. Imagine walking past a store where digital images seem to float on the glass—this captures attention more effectively than traditional displays ever could.

Retail environments benefit immensely from such innovations. A transparent LED screen serves not only as a display tool but also an architectural element due to its lightweight and thin design. For instance, these screens offer brightness levels of up to 6000 nits, ensuring visibility even in direct sunlight, which is often challenging for regular LED screens. These high brightness levels make them suitable for outdoor and indoor settings, expanding their versatility. Plus, they come in various pixel pitches, commonly ranging from 3mm to 10mm, which allows customization based on viewing distance and clarity requirements.

Energy efficiency represents another significant selling point. Consumption rates are often as low as 10 watts per sqft compared to traditional screens, which helps reduce overall energy costs. This efficiency not only supports eco-friendly initiatives but also cuts down on the long-term operational costs for businesses—a pressing concern in today’s economic landscape. Industry reports support these claims, often highlighting transparent screens as a cost-effective measure due to their reduced power usage.

In public spaces or corporate environments, integrating these screens can transform the ambiance without obstructing views. Compared to LED video walls, transparent screens require less structural reinforcement because of their lower weight, which can often be as little as 14 kg per square meter. This property reduces installation time and associated labor costs, providing significant savings over time. Industry feedback often points out this ease of integration as a crucial factor in their rapid adoption across various sectors. For example, train stations globally have started incorporating these screens for real-time information displays without compromising the transparency of their environments.
